kvm虚拟机共享文件夹,KVM虚拟机共享文件夹的使用方法详解
- 综合资讯
- 2024-11-08 17:54:14
- 1

KVM虚拟机共享文件夹,可简化文件传输和共享。使用方法包括:1.在宿主机和虚拟机中创建同名文件夹;2.在虚拟机中挂载宿主机文件夹;3.配置自动挂载;4.测试共享文件夹。...
KVM虚拟机共享文件夹,可简化文件传输和共享。使用方法包括:1.在宿主机和虚拟机中创建同名文件夹;2.在虚拟机中挂载宿主机文件夹;3.配置自动挂载;4.测试共享文件夹。详细步骤可参考相关教程。
KVM(Kernel-based Virtual Machine)是一种基于Linux内核的虚拟化技术,具有高性能、易用性和安全性等优点,在KVM虚拟机中,共享文件夹功能可以实现虚拟机与主机之间的文件共享,方便用户进行数据交换和协同工作,本文将详细介绍KVM虚拟机共享文件夹的使用方法。
准备工作
1、确保您的系统中已安装KVM模块和QEMU。
2、在主机上创建一个共享文件夹,用于存放虚拟机共享的文件。
3、确保虚拟机已启动,并配置好网络。
在虚拟机中配置共享文件夹
1、登录到虚拟机。
2、打开终端,输入以下命令创建一个共享文件夹:
sudo mkdir -p /var/lib/libvirt/images/shared_folder
3、设置共享文件夹的权限,确保虚拟机可以访问:
sudo chmod 775 /var/lib/libvirt/images/shared_folder sudo chown root:root /var/lib/libvirt/images/shared_folder
4、查看共享文件夹的挂载点:
df -h
5、根据实际情况,将共享文件夹挂载到虚拟机中的某个目录,例如/mnt/shared_folder
:
sudo mount -t vboxsf -o defaults,umask=0 shared_folder /mnt/shared_folder
6、添加挂载点到/etc/fstab
文件中,确保虚拟机重启后挂载点仍然有效:
echo 'shared_folder /mnt/shared_folder vboxsf defaults,umask=0 0 0' >> /etc/fstab
在主机上配置共享文件夹
1、打开终端,输入以下命令安装Samba服务:
sudo apt-get install samba
2、创建一个Samba用户,用于访问共享文件夹:
sudo smbpasswd -a username
3、编辑/etc/samba/smb.conf
文件,添加以下内容:
[shared_folder] path = /var/lib/libvirt/images/shared_folder valid users = username writable = yes browsable = yes
4、重启Samba服务:
sudo systemctl restart smbd
在虚拟机中访问共享文件夹
1、登录到虚拟机。
2、打开终端,输入以下命令访问共享文件夹:
sudo mount -t cifs //hostname/shared_folder /mnt/shared_folder -o username=username,password=password
hostname
为主机IP地址或主机名,username
和password
分别为Samba用户名和密码。
本文详细介绍了KVM虚拟机共享文件夹的使用方法,包括在虚拟机和主机上配置共享文件夹,以及在虚拟机中访问共享文件夹,通过共享文件夹,用户可以方便地在虚拟机与主机之间交换文件,提高工作效率,希望本文对您有所帮助。
本文由智淘云于2024-11-08发表在智淘云,如有疑问,请联系我们。
本文链接:https://zhitaoyun.cn/686414.html
本文链接:https://zhitaoyun.cn/686414.html
发表评论